Subject: SQL lint cut-over done

Team — we finished moving all of Quillbase's SQL files to the new sqlfix ruleset last night. Old perl checker is deleted. Uppercase keywords, mandatory trailing commas, 120-char limit. CI blocks on violations; no warnings tier anymore. Legacy migrations under /archive are exempt via pragma. Don't re-add the old hooks. For reference, the linter runs with the following settings in every pipeline.

service settings:
WENATH_PIN=5007
WENATH_METRICS_HOST=metrics.wenath.tolvaqlabs.corp
WENATH_LOG_LEVEL=debug
WENATH_TENANT=rusox

**TICKET BW-3127: Blue-green deploys for billing worker**

Enable blue-green deployment for the Tallyloom billing worker. Green pool must drain in-flight invoice jobs before cutover; max drain window 10 minutes. Health check: queue depth below 50 and zero failed charges in the last 5 minutes. Contractor note: do not trigger cutover manually — use the deploy pipeline only. This ticket requires sign-off before merge from the responsible engineer.

account owner for kafop-haweg: Pelax Gilael Istir

- Log compaction is now enabled by default on all Brimvault topics. Segments older than the retention horizon are compacted rather than truncated; plugins relying on raw offset gaps must migrate to the new tombstone API.
- Compaction runs in a background lane; plugin hooks fire after each pass, not per-segment.
- Deprecated: compact_legacy mode, removed in 4.0.
- Plugins reading internal segment files directly will break. Test against the 3.2 sandbox before release. Questions on compaction behavior go to the maintainer below.

account owner for fajep-yagef: Kasix Eliiel